Output d8bf30bfc016d82e2de3aa5ccdd750147c7d94b05001c4be210eab70cb27f52f:1

value
22389
script pubkey
OP_0 OP_PUSHBYTES_20 b7b40181a2768bfeddf0b38515cdd89428353106
address
bc1qk76qrqdzw69lah0skwz3tnwcjs5r2vgxe67ax3
transaction
d8bf30bfc016d82e2de3aa5ccdd750147c7d94b05001c4be210eab70cb27f52f
confirmations
170059
spent
true